Before each release of the Quillcart checkout flow, we run a full load test against the staging cluster in the Fernhollow environment. Please verify that the payment stub service is warmed up first, as cold starts skew latency numbers significantly. Record the p95 and p99 results in the release ticket. The load test parameters and scheduling calendar are maintained on the page below.

runbook for hahap-baduf: https://jira.qorvelsys.internal/projects/projects/pages/projects/c0cb

[ ] Verify the Lanternfall data-retention sweeper honors the 90-day policy across all Quillmark tenant shards, including soft-deleted records and orphaned attachment blobs. Confirm the dry-run report from staging matches production row counts within tolerance, and that the sweeper's audit log is itself exempt from deletion for the mandated seven-year window. Sign-off requires the security reviewer to validate the deletion manifest against the retention matrix. The trace token for the verified sweep run is recorded directly below.

build token for tawip-yageg: htk9_92ac43d42

Subject: Quickstore 4.2 — bloom filter now fronts the KV layer

Plugin authors: starting with this release, Quickstore places a bloom filter ahead of the key-value store. Negative lookups return faster; false positives fall through safely. No API changes are required on your side. Verify your plugin against the staging build referenced below.

session token of fahif-tadup = htk3_9c7

Subject: Garage occupancy feed — new reviewer of record

As of this sprint, review responsibility for the Stallport occupancy feed is changing. All pull requests touching the sensor ingest, the stale-reading filter, or the per-level availability counts must be routed to the new owner before merge. The old CODEOWNERS entry has been updated; please refresh your local clone. Backfill scripts for the Harrowgate garage are included in this scope. Direct review requests to the person named below.

named custodian: Brivan Eliath Quenox Frador